Wells Fargo Bank NA v. Rosendo Santana
Plaintiff: Wells Fargo Bank NA
Defendant: Rosendo Santana
Case Number: 3:2010cv00923
Filed: May 7, 2010
Court: US District Court for the Northern District of Texas
Office: Dallas Office
County: XX US, Outside State
Presiding Judge: Jane J Boyle
Nature of Suit: Rent, Lease, and Ejectment
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 1332
Jury Demanded By: None

December 20, 2010 Opinion or Order Filing 11 Memorandum Opinion and Order: Because this case could be remanded either because Santana is a citizen of Texas or because he has failed to sufficiently demonstrate that the amount in controversy requirement has been met for diversity jurisdiction purposes, this case is hereby REMANDED to the court from which it was removed, the Dallas County Civil Court at Law Number Two. (see order) (Ordered by Judge Jane J Boyle on 12/20/2010) (tln)
